What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Food Court Worker,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Food Court Worker, you need strong customer service skills, basic math abilities, and knowledge of food safety practices, usually supported by a high school diploma or equivalent. Familiarity with point-of-sale (POS) systems, cash registers, and food preparation equipment is commonly required. Excellent communication, teamwork, and the ability to work efficiently under pressure are standout soft skills for this role. These competencies ensure smooth operations, customer satisfaction, and adherence to health and safety standards in a busy food service environment.

What are food court workers?

Food court workers are employees who prepare, serve, and sell food and beverages in a food court, which is a shared dining area with multiple food vendors, typically found in malls, airports, or large commercial centers. Their duties may include taking orders, handling payments, preparing food, maintaining cleanliness, and providing customer service. Food court workers often rotate between different stations and must work quickly in a fast-paced environment. Good communication and teamwork skills are essential for success in this role.

What are the typical responsibilities of someone working in a food court environment?

In a food court role, your daily tasks usually include taking customer orders, preparing and serving food, maintaining cleanliness in both the kitchen and dining areas, and ensuring that food safety standards are met. You may also be responsible for restocking supplies, handling cash or payments, and providing friendly customer service. Teamwork is essential, as you'll often collaborate with colleagues to manage busy periods and ensure efficient service. This environment is fast-paced, and strong communication skills are valuable for coordinating with both your team and customers.

Job description

Starting Wage: $16.79 hour plus tips
The Food Court Barista is responsible for providing food and beverage services out of the Coastal Roasters food outlet.
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S AND RESPONSIBILITIES
  • Provides prompt service to guests, completing food and beverage orders accurately and efficiently.
  • Monitors guests needs on a continual basis, ensuring quality and accuracy of orders.
  • Understands and learns all functions of Coastal Roasters.
  • Remains knowledgeable on all menu items, giving suggestions and assistance to guests as needed.
  • Opens and closes Coastal Roasters as scheduled, ensuring areas are properly stocked and ready for next shift.
  • Completes side work duties and document on necessary forms.
  • Sanitizes and deep cleans display cases, fridges, freezers and other equipment used for food/beverage products.
  • Processes payments and monitors cash drawer for organization while keeping the drawer balanced.
  • Demonstrates exceptional guest service by having an excellent attitude when dealing with guests and Team Members.
  • Closely follows the F&B department health and personal hygiene policy.
  • Other duties as directed by management.

WORK ENVIRONMENT
While performing the duties of this job, Team Members may be exposed to secondhand tobacco smoke, including regular exposure for those working on the casino floor. The noise level in the work environment is usually moderate and can occasionally reach a high level for short periods of time.
EXPERIENCE, EDUCATION AND ELIGIBILITY
  • Minimum age requirement for this position is 18 years old.
  • Possess or obtain a Food Handlers Card within 30 days of employment.
  • Must have an OLCC Permit at the time of hire.
  • Ability to communicate clearly and effectively in English, verbally, in writing or by other acceptable means.
  • Comply with pre-employment, random and reasonable suspicion alcohol and drug testing.
  • Receive and maintain a valid gaming license from the CTCLUSI Tribal Gaming Commission.
  • Availability to work all shifts including weekends and holidays based on the needs of the department and for special casino events.

PHYSICAL REQUIREMENTS
  • Must be able to sit, stand and/or walk for up to 8 hours.
  • Must be able to carry, reach, twist, bend and squat frequently.
  • Must regularly lift and /or move up to 25 pounds and occasionally lift and/or move up to 75 pounds with assistance as needed.
